Early Life and Career
Eleanor Powell was born in Springfield, Massachusetts. She began seriously studying dance at the age of 11 and by 17, she was already performing on a grand stage. With her femininity, grace, and professionalism, she instantly won the hearts of Broadway audiences.

Hollywood Career
In , Eleanor Powell ventured into Hollywood. She made her debut in the film "George White's Scandals." The work was a success, receiving approval from critics and audiences. However, the filmmaking experience disappointed Powell and cooled her interest in the industry.
Movie studios and directors had to put in a lot of effort to convince her to continue acting.

The film became a sensation, and Eleanor instantly became a Hollywood star.
Afterwards, she had prominent roles in films such as "Born to Dance," "Rosalie," "Honolulu," "Lady Be Good," "Ship Ahoy," "I Dood It," "Sensations of ," and "Duchess of Idaho." Eleanor skillfully brought to life a variety of characters.
Her heroines were always vibrant and interesting, greatly appealing to her fans. The actress mesmerized audiences with her gestures and glances, making them ponder the hidden meanings behind her speeches and intonations.
